Output ec968a6e61b414c3a65f0f717ebbc4e843341ad29b12fe90f4e5b8960469f874:1

value
1767023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a83b7731e1b32cea23df5657c43b352ed114a2e OP_EQUAL
address
372QuVwQpgDhEAkQqCtg6fHU6AERyhEjJ9
transaction
ec968a6e61b414c3a65f0f717ebbc4e843341ad29b12fe90f4e5b8960469f874
confirmations
349141
spent
true